  • Hydrogen Peroxide: Oxygenates the skin while decongesting and purifying clogged pores.
  • Salicylic Acid: A beta-hydroxy acid that refines texture, clears congested pores, and helps control oil production.
  • Retinyl Palmitate: Stable form of vitamin A that offers antioxidant protection and counteracts the appearance of dry, flaky skin.
  • Panthenol (Vitamin B5): A powerful natural moisturizer, healer, and protector that rebuilds the barrier and acts as a shield against irritation.
  • Jojoba: An emollient plant oil that is most similar in structure to our own sebum. Provides antioxidant support and relieves skin irritation.

Prepare
Cleanse skin thoroughly and pat completely dry.

Apply
Dispense a pea-sized amount and apply a thin, even layer to acne-prone areas or the full face as needed. A little goes a long way with this formula.

Technique
Use fingertips to press gently into the skin rather than rubbing. This minimizes friction on inflamed skin and supports better absorption of the active ingredients.

Frequency
Begin with once-daily use (evening recommended) to assess skin tolerance. Once skin has adjusted, twice-daily use is appropriate for most skin types. Always follow with SPF 30+ in the morning, as salicylic acid and retinyl palmitate both increase photosensitivity.
